Crafting the Perfect Handmade Romantic Rose Perfume: A Guide to Natural Fragrance Creation

Step-by-Step Guide to Crafting Your Handmade Romantic Rose Perfume

Making your own romantic rose perfume might seem like a complicated task, but trust me, it’s far simpler than it appears. With just a few ingredients and a little patience, you can create a beautiful, natural perfume that’s completely unique to you. Let’s walk through the process together!

1. Gather Your Materials

Before you start, you’ll need to collect a few essential materials. Here’s what you’ll need:

  • Essential oils: Rose essential oil (the heart of your fragrance), along with other complementary oils like lavender, geranium, or jasmine.
  • Carrier oil: This is the base of your perfume, and it helps dilute the essential oils. I recommend jojoba oil or fractionated coconut oil.
  • Perfume bottle: A glass spray bottle works best for storing your perfume.
  • Alcohol (optional): Some recipes require alcohol to help preserve the scent and ensure it lasts longer on your skin.
  • Small funnel and pipette: These tools help in mixing and measuring the oils with precision.

2. Choose Your Rose Scent Profile

There are many varieties of rose essential oil, each with its own subtle differences. Bulgarian rose oil is known for its rich, deep scent, while Damask rose oil offers a more delicate and sweet fragrance. You can even mix different rose oils to create a custom rose fragrance that speaks to your personal preferences. In addition to rose, you might want to blend other floral or citrus notes to create a balanced perfume that isn’t overwhelming.

3. Prepare Your Base

Once you’ve selected your rose oils and any additional scents, it’s time to prepare the base. This is where the carrier oil comes in. Add about 10-20 drops of rose essential oil (or a combination of rose oils) to a small glass bottle. Then, add about 2 tablespoons of your carrier oil. If you’re using alcohol to help your perfume last longer, you can substitute part of the carrier oil with alcohol. The ratio will vary depending on your preference, but generally, 70% carrier oil to 30% alcohol works well.

4. Mix Your Perfume

Now comes the fun part: mixing! Using a pipette, slowly add the rose essential oil to the base, one drop at a time, until you’re satisfied with the strength of the scent. Keep in mind that essential oils are highly concentrated, so a little goes a long way. If you’re adding other oils, like lavender or geranium, be sure to start with a few drops and adjust as needed. Remember, perfume is about balance and creating something that feels harmonious, not overpowering.

5. Let It Mature

Once your perfume is mixed, it’s time to let it sit and mature for at least 48 hours. This allows the oils to blend together and deepen in complexity. Keep the perfume in a cool, dark place during this period. After a couple of days, you can test the perfume to see how it’s developed. If you feel like it needs more rose or another note, feel free to adjust it during this time.

Tips for Perfecting Your Handmade Rose Perfume

As you experiment with making your own rose perfumes, here are a few tips to keep in mind:

  • Start small: Don’t be afraid to experiment with small batches before making a larger amount. This will give you a chance to test and adjust your formula.
  • Trust your nose: Perfume crafting is a very personal experience. Go with what smells best to you!
  • Patience is key: Allow your perfume time to mature and develop fully before making final adjustments.
  • Store properly: To ensure the longevity of your perfume, store it in a dark, cool place. Perfume can deteriorate if exposed to direct sunlight or heat.
